1. Simple Painted Facade Low Cost Normal House Front Elevation Design

Choose a single, light colour for the entire facade, such as white or beige. Add dark-coloured window frames and doors for contrast, using shades like black or navy blue. If you want a bright front elevation design, this is appropriate. This low-cost front elevation design requires minimum maintenance and, therefore, helps in saving on that as well. This is because it is easy to maintain. The use of a simple colour scheme highlights its architectural details.
| Style | Maintenance | Materials Used | Cost (INR) | Highlights | Best For |
| Minimalist | Low | Cement plaster, exterior paint | 50,000 – 1,50,000 | Clean, bright, easy to repaint | Small houses, budget-friendly |
2. Mixed Material Front Low-Cost Normal House Front Elevation Design

Combine brick and plaster for a unique look. Bricks should be used around the entrance area, and plaster should be used for the rest of the front elevation wall. To get the aesthetics correct, choose the classic colour combination of red bricks and off-white plaster. The mix of materials adds texture and interest.
| Style | Maintenance | Materials Used | Cost (INR) | Highlights | Best For |
| Modern/Contemporary | Medium | Brick, cement plaster, paint | 1,50,000 – 3,00,000 | Texture contrast with bricks + plaster | Single/double-storey homes |

5. Low-Cost Front Elevation Designs for Small Houses with Horizontal Stripes

Paint horizontal stripes on the facades using two or three complementary colours, such as beige, white, and light blue. Stripes can make your home wider. It is one of the best ways of enhancing your house front elevation on a tight budget. You can customise the style, fit, and sizes of stripes according to your house's appearance.
| Style | Maintenance | Materials Used | Cost (INR) | Highlights | Best For |
| Modern | Low | Cement plaster, paint | 50,000 – 1,50,000 | Visually widens facade | Narrow front plots |

20. Concrete Jali Screen Home Elevation Design for Affordable Homes

Concrete Jali screen front elevation design is an affordable and fashionable way to design cheap houses. This design increases natural ventilation and lighting while providing privacy. The concrete blocks with patterns provide aesthetic appeal and help in keeping the houses cool by reducing heat gain.
| Style | Maintenance | Materials Used | Cost (INR) | Highlights | Best For |
| Modern/Traditional Blend | Low | Precast concrete jali blocks, | 80,000 – 2,50,000 | Airflow, light, decorative patterns | Budget homes, hot climates |
How to Choose the Best Front Elevation Design?
The visual appeal of your home depends on the elevation design. Therefore, choosing the best design is essential, as that can enhance your home's curb appeal. Here are a few factors that you need to focus on while finalising a design:
- Consider Your Budget: Remember your budget, and choose materials and designs that fit your financial plan.
- Think About Your Style: Decide if you want a modern, traditional, or mixed style. Your house should reflect your taste.
- Check Local Climate: Choose materials that suit your local weather. Some materials work better in hot, cold, or rainy climates.
- Focus on Functionality: Ensure the design is practical. It should provide good ventilation, sunlight, and easy maintenance.
- Look at the Surroundings: Make sure your design blends well with the neighbourhood. Your house should complement nearby homes.
- Use Quality Materials: Pick durable and long-lasting materials. This will save you money on repairs in the future.
- Get Professional Advice: Consult with an architect or designer. They can offer valuable insights and suggestions.
- Visualise the Design: Use design tools or sketches to visualize how the final design will look. This helps you make better decisions.
- Plan for the Future: Consider your long-term needs and choose a design that will still suit you in the coming years.
